Who Are Small World’s Main Customers?
Understanding the Growth Strategy of Small World involves a deep dive into its primary customer segments. The company, which focuses on financial services, primarily caters to consumers (B2C). Their target market is largely composed of migrant workers who send remittances to their families.
The core of the customer demographics typically falls within the 25-55 age range. These individuals often have lower to middle-income levels. They are driven by the need to support family members in their home countries. This focus on family is a key aspect of their customer profile.
Historically, the company has served cash-reliant customers. However, there's been a notable shift towards digital channels. This change reflects the increasing adoption of mobile banking and online platforms. This shift has prompted investment in digital capabilities to reach a broader audience.
The primary age range for the target market is between 25 and 55 years old. Income levels are typically in the lower to middle range. This demographic profile informs the company's service offerings.
Occupations often include labor, service industry roles, or skilled trades. Educational backgrounds vary from vocational to tertiary. This diversity reflects the broad range of skills within the customer base.
Family status is a critical factor, with many customers sending money to spouses, children, or elderly parents. The need to support family is a primary motivator for using the services. This drives the customer segmentation strategy.
There is a noticeable shift towards digital channels, including mobile banking. This trend is influencing the company's investment in digital platforms. The company is adapting to the changing preferences of its target market.

What Do Small World’s Customers Want?
Understanding customer needs and preferences is crucial for any business, and for the money transfer industry, it's especially important. The core of Small World Company's business revolves around meeting the specific needs of its customers. This involves providing services that are not only reliable and affordable but also convenient for sending money internationally.
The primary driver for Small World Company's customers is the need for a trustworthy and cost-effective way to send money across borders. This is often coupled with the desire for a convenient and user-friendly experience. The company's success hinges on its ability to address these needs by offering competitive exchange rates, low fees, and various payout options, such as bank deposits, cash pickups, and mobile wallets.
The target market for Small World Company is primarily driven by the practical and emotional need to support family. This includes providing funds for living expenses, education, and healthcare. This understanding of customer needs is critical for effective marketing and service development.
Customers actively seek the best exchange rates to maximize the value of their transfers. This is a primary consideration when choosing a money transfer service. The company's ability to offer favorable rates directly impacts customer satisfaction and retention.
Minimizing fees is a key factor for customers, as it directly affects the amount of money received by the recipient. Transparent and low fees are essential for attracting and retaining customers. This is a critical component of Small World Company's value proposition.
Offering multiple payout options, such as bank deposits, cash pickups, and mobile wallets, caters to the diverse needs of customers and recipients. This flexibility enhances convenience and accessibility, which are important for customer satisfaction. The availability of various payout methods is a significant differentiator.
Building trust is paramount in the money transfer industry. Customers prioritize services they believe are secure and reliable. Ensuring the safety of transactions and providing dependable service is crucial for customer loyalty. This is a core aspect of Small World Company's brand.
The speed at which money arrives is a key consideration, especially when funds are needed urgently. Fast and efficient transfers are highly valued by customers. The ability to deliver timely transfers is a competitive advantage.
Convenient access to service points, whether physical locations or digital platforms, is essential for customer convenience. Easy access to services increases customer satisfaction. This includes a user-friendly mobile app and a wide agent network.
The company addresses the historical complexities and high costs associated with traditional banking channels by offering transparent fee structures and a user-friendly interface. Customer feedback, particularly regarding the ease of use of their mobile app and the availability of local payout options, has influenced product development. Continuous improvements in their digital platforms and expansion of their agent network in key receiving countries are ongoing. Where does Small World operate?
The geographical market presence of the company is extensive, concentrating on key remittance corridors globally. This includes regions with significant migrant populations sending money to areas like Africa, Asia, and Latin America. The company's market strategy is heavily influenced by the diverse customer demographics and preferences across these regions, which necessitates a localized approach to service delivery.
The company often holds a strong market share or brand recognition in specific corridors where it has established a robust agent network and strong community ties. The company's expansion efforts have recently focused on strengthening their digital footprint in emerging markets. This strategic focus allows the company to cater to the specific needs of its diverse customer base, ensuring that services are accessible and relevant across various geographical locations.
The company's operations are tailored to meet the specific needs of its customers, such as providing mobile wallet payouts in some African markets, while bank deposits are more common in parts of Asia. The company localizes its offerings by partnering with local banks and mobile money operators, tailoring marketing campaigns to specific cultural contexts, and offering customer support in relevant languages. The company's commitment to understanding and adapting to the diverse needs of its customers is a key factor in its continued success and expansion in the global remittance market.

How Does Small World Win & Keep Customers?
Customer acquisition and retention are crucial for the success of any financial service, and the company, which focuses on money transfers, employs a multi-channel strategy to attract and keep its customers. This approach is tailored to effectively reach and serve its target market. The company leverages various marketing channels and sales tactics to gain new customers and build long-term relationships.
The company's customer acquisition strategies involve digital advertising, social media campaigns, and traditional media. They also use word-of-mouth marketing and referral programs. These efforts are often supported by competitive pricing and the emphasis on speed and reliability. All of these are key factors in attracting the target audience.
Customer retention is a key focus, driven by consistent service quality and competitive exchange rates. The company also utilizes a growing network of payout locations to make it easier for customers to receive money. The company uses customer data to understand transfer patterns and optimize its service offerings. CRM systems likely play a role in managing customer interactions and providing personalized support. The company utilizes digital advertising platforms to target specific demographics within the diaspora communities. Campaigns are designed to reach potential customers through online channels. This includes search engine marketing and display advertising to increase brand visibility.
Social media campaigns are tailored to engage with specific diaspora communities. The company uses platforms like Facebook, Instagram, and others to share content. Targeted ads and community engagement are key to building brand awareness and trust.
Traditional media, such as print and radio, is used in areas with high immigrant populations. These channels help reach customers who may not be active online. Advertisements are placed in community-focused publications and radio stations.
Word-of-mouth and referral programs are highly effective due to strong community ties. The company encourages existing customers to refer friends and family. Referral bonuses and incentives are often used to boost this strategy.
The company uses competitive pricing to attract customers. This includes offering favorable exchange rates and low fees. Promotions and discounts are often used to gain a competitive edge in the market.
The company emphasizes the speed and reliability of its money transfer services. This is a key selling point for customers. Fast and dependable transfers build trust and customer loyalty.
